1. Naman Dhir
Naman Dhir did play in all 14 matches of the 2026 IPL season. However, if Suryakumar is unavailable for selection in 2027, the 26-year-old will have to take a lot more responsibility with the bat in the middle order. Throughout the season, Dhir batted at number three, where he scored 318 runs at a strike-rate of 147.22.
If MI are without the former India captain next season, they can promote captain-in-waiting Tilak Varma to bat at number three, something India does in T20I, and have Dhir bat at number four.
